STRATEGIC COMMUNICATIONS
Today, more than ever, it is critical that organizations take a strategic approach to communications, creating a plan with a goal in mind. In addition to emphasizing what is important to the organization and creating brand recognition, a strategic approach frames the message and defines the narrative. This builds reputation and adds credibility to the organization and those associated with it.
Long-term relationship development with active stakeholder involvement is key to an effective communications strategy. Knowing who is important to your organization and its goals helps build trust and gain buy-in while reducing project risks and providing opportunities for collaboration.

ISSUES MANAGEMENT
The Public Affairs Council describes issues management as “the process of prioritizing and proactively addressing public policy and reputation issues that can affect an organization's success.”
